This cheesy chicken burrito casserole is a delightful fusion of seasoned chicken, rice, beans, and cheese, baked to perfection. It’s richly flavored with spices and topped with a golden layer of melted cheese, offering a savory bite in every spoonful.

Ingredients

  • 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
  • 1 can (15 oz) black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 cup cooked rice (white or brown)
  • 1 can (10 oz) diced tomatoes with green chilies
  • 1 cup corn (fresh, frozen, or canned)
  • 1 teaspoon taco seasoning
  • 2 cups shredded cheese (cheddar or Mexican blend)
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ro (optional)
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Tortilla chips or tortillas for serving

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350ยฐF (175ยฐC).
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the shredded chicken, black beans, cooked rice, diced tomatoes, corn, taco seasoning, and sour cream.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  3. Spread half of the mixture in a greased 9×13 inch baking dish. Sprinkle half of the shredded cheese on top.
  4. Layer the remaining chicken mixture on top and finish with the remaining cheese.
  5. Cover with aluminum foil and bake for 25 minutes. Remove the foil and bake for an additional 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is bubbly and golden.
  6. Remove from the oven and let it cool for a few minutes. Garnish with fresh cilantro if desired.
  7. Serve hot with tortilla chips or wrapped in tortillas.

Cook and Prep Times

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 40 minutes
  • Total Time: 55 minutes
  • Servings: 6 portions
  • Calories: 450kcal
  • Fat: 20g
  • Protein: 30g
  • Carbohydrates: 40g
